Fellow 'Westie with itchy nether regions' owner here! Apoquel did absolutely nothing for her. The best steroid we have found for her is Medrone and we bathe at least twice a week in Maloseb. We find when she's having an 'itchy bits' situation we bathe the area morning and night with just warm water and apply a thin layer of Sudocrem. Our vet OK'd Sudocrem after we told her the cream she prescribed didn't work. But never use Savlon as it has something which dogs can't have in it.
